What is Giclée?
A modern printmaking process in which individual prints are produced on a special large-format printer in extremely high resolution, to give as exact as possible a reproduction of the precise colors and strokes of the original work. The giclée process offers the highest-quality reproduction available. Giclées may be printed on paper or on canvas. They are rarely produced in editions larger than a few hundred, with each one printed individually.

"Richard" Zu Ming Ho was born in China in 1949. At an early age he had a true appreciation for art and was considered to be highly gifted in several different media and styles, including classic Chinese painting styles. He was also greatly influenced by the French Impressionists masters.

The Communist regime made an attempt to suppress Zu Ming by placing him into a labor camp where he had no access to the pastime he loved. Surprisingly he maintained high spirits by creating images in his head, trying to memorize the images so that they could one day materialize on canvas. He remained in the camp for ten long years.

In 1987 Zu Ming Ho traveled to the United States, celebrating his freedom to exercise his amazing talent. He creates very cultured and meaningful pieces that continue to gain him great recognition around the world. His combination of soft brush strokes and vibrant colors are often the reason his technique is referred to as poetic.
